Benton Elementary School is located in Marshall, MO and is one of 5 elementary schools in Marshall School District. It is a public school that serves 226 students in grades K-1.
Benton Elementary School did not make AYP in 2011. Under No Child Left Behind, a school makes Adequate Yearly Progress (AYP) if it achieves the minimum levels of improvement determined by the state of Missouri in terms of student performance and other accountability measures. Student Economic Level (2011)
In 2011, Benton Elementary School had 76% of students eligible for free or reduced price lunch programs. Missouri had 44% of eligible students for free or reduced price lunch programs. Eligibility for the National School Lunch Program is based on family income levels.

Marshall District Spending
$8,297Per Pupil
The Marshall spends $8,297 per pupil in current expenditures. The district spends 65% on instruction, 30% on support services, 5% on other elementary and secondary expenditures. More about Marshall District
